One of BC's rarest creatures has been selected by VANOC to be an Olympic mascot for the Vancouver 2010 Games. Inspired by local mythology of the Pacific Northwest First Nations, Miga is a "sea bear" - part killer whale and part Spirit Bear. Legend has it that orca whales would transform on land into the rare Kermode or Spirit Bear.
The First Nations believe that the Spirit Bear was turned white by the Raven to remind us of the Ice Age. They also believe that orcas are travellers and guardians of the sea.
Miga, apparently lives in the ocean near Tofino and spends the summers surfing at Long Beach and in the winters has taken up snowboarding. I'm not sure where, perhaps at Mount Washington on the Island? Like most Spirit Bears her favourite food is salmon.
Great choice by VANOC of Miga and the other two mascots, Sumi (a thunderbird, orca and black bear) and Quatchi (a Sasquatch), who aren't just cute toys but may also be seen as "protectors of nature" here in BC.
